If you haven't travelled through Manchester Airport (MAN) in the last few months, you are in for a surprise. As of March 2026, the airport has officially moved to a simplified, high-tech layout. For travellers the way you arrive and depart has fundamentally changed.

The End of Terminal 1

After 63 years of service, the original Terminal 1 has officially closed its doors to departing flights. The space is being repurposed to allow for the expansion of Terminal 3.

  • Terminal 2 (The "Super Terminal"): Now handles roughly 75-80% of all passengers. If you are flying with Emirates, easyJet, Jet2, British Airways, TUI, or Virgin Atlantic, you are now using the revamped T2.

  • Terminal 3: Now primarily serves Ryanair.

The "No Barrier" Revolution

The biggest change for 2026 is the removal of physical barriers at the Terminal 2 Express Drop-Off and the T2 West Multi-Storey (now renamed P3).

Manchester Airport has moved to an ANPR (Automatic Number Plate Recognition) system. There are no more ticket machines at the exit. You simply drive in, drop off or pick up, and drive out.

  • The Catch: You must pay the fee online by midnight the following day.

  • The Penalty: Failure to pay results in a £100 Parking Charge Notice, which can be a sour end to any holiday.
